Everything we do is for the best interests of our animals in our care. Our adoption process is aimed at matching you, your family and your current pets with our animals for adoption.
An adoption counselor (or volunteer) will introduce you to our animals in a private meeting room. We will share information about the animal's history and needs, behavior assessment and any volunteer / staff comments.
When you find the right pet for you and your family, the adoption counselor will assist you in completing the proper paperwork. This process includes signing an adoption contract, reviewing medical history (provided by WPHS) and providing proper pet care information. This process takes approximately 30 minutes to complete.

Holds - no holds will be accepted over the phone - everyone must have had interaction with the animal.
A $15.00 meet and greet hold may be placed on an animal for meet and greet with other dogs in the home only. This deposit holds an animal for a maximum of 24 hours. This deposit can be applied to the adoption fee.
A $25.00 meet the family deposit may be placed on an animal if we are requiring that other members of the family meet the animal. This deposit is non-refundable but can be applied to the adoption fee.
Adoptions are approved for the first qualified home.
